Preloader
img

Event Handling dalam JavaScript

Event handling adalah cara JavaScript merespons aksi pengguna seperti klik, ketikan keyboard, atau gerakan mouse. Dengan event, sebuah halaman web dapat menjadi interaktif dan responsif terhadap input pengguna.

Developer biasanya menggunakan metode addEventListener untuk menangani event. Cara ini lebih disarankan dibandingkan menuliskan event langsung di HTML karena lebih terorganisir dan fleksibel.

Event handling juga bisa diterapkan untuk skenario kompleks, seperti navigasi di aplikasi SPA (Single Page Application). Dengan event, aplikasi dapat mengatur logika tanpa perlu me-reload halaman.